Title : 
An RF front-end for multi-channel direct RF sampling cable receivers

            Abstract : 
This paper presents a broadband fully integrated high dynamic range RF front-end with a single-inductor programmable RF amplitude equalizer, 45dB variable gain range, 4.5dB NF, 60dB CSO/CTB, and 25dB anti-aliasing protection. It is designed in a 40GHz-ft BiCMOS 0.25μm process, consumes 400mW from a 3.3V supply, and enables a cable full-spectrum receiver to capture >;16 channels over an 50MHz-1GHz RF band.
